Re: mythtv fails to install



On Sat, Nov 08, 2014 at 06:46:04PM -0500, Rodney D. Myers wrote:
> attempting to get mythtv-common installed, but i keep getting this
> error in the shell;
> 
> sudo apt-get install -f  mythtv-common 
> Reading package lists... Done
> Building dependency tree       
> Reading state information... Done
> The following extra packages will be installed:
>   mythtv-doc
> The following NEW packages will be installed:
>   mythtv-common mythtv-doc
> 0 upgraded, 2 newly installed, 0 to remove and 0 not upgraded.
> Need to get 167 kB/14.5 MB of archives.
> After this operation, 29.8 MB of additional disk space will be used.
> Do you want to continue? [Y/n] 
> Get:1 http://www.deb-multimedia.org/ testing/main mythtv-doc all
> 0.27.4+fixes20141029-dmo1 [167 kB] Fetched 167 kB in 1s (121 kB/s)      
> Preconfiguring packages ...
> Selecting previously unselected package mythtv-common.
> (Reading database ... 219224 files and directories currently installed.)
> Preparing to
> unpack .../mythtv-common_0.27.4+fixes20141029-dmo1_all.deb ...
> Unpacking mythtv-common (0.27.4+fixes20141029-dmo1) ... Selecting
> previously unselected package mythtv-doc. Preparing to
> unpack .../mythtv-doc_0.27.4+fixes20141029-dmo1_all.deb ... Unpacking
> mythtv-doc (0.27.4+fixes20141029-dmo1) ... Setting up mythtv-common
> (0.27.4+fixes20141029-dmo1) ... useradd: group mythtv exists - if you
> want to add this user to that group, use -g. dpkg: error processing
> package mythtv-common (--configure): subprocess installed
> post-installation script returned error exit status 9 Setting up
> mythtv-doc (0.27.4+fixes20141029-dmo1) ... Errors were encountered
> while processing: mythtv-common
> E: Sub-process /usr/bin/dpkg returned an error code (1)

Right, you have an existing mythtv group.

You could change the name of that group in /etc/group from
mythtv to mythtv-old, then install mythtv packages again, 
then run a find over your whole filesystem to convert mythtv-old
files to mythtv.

You could also file a bug report with the people who run
deb-multimedia.org.
